About a month ago I adopted 6 embden geese from the animal shelter... The jailbirds got sent to the pokie for eating the neighbors corn seedlings, after the owner failed to contain them. The animal control seemed really heavy handed with them, and now I have a goose with what appears to be a broken wing... She still flaps it, but isn't holding it right... They are very distrustful of people, and i was wondering if this was a breed characteristic or just from being man handled? After a month they still hiss at me, though they do wait on me in the morning honking for their breakfast... Anyone with suggestions on making friends with my new additions.

I hope your geese will begin to trust you soon. I've been sitting outside with the two several times a day so they know I'm a safe "zone" for them. Maybe you could try the same thing and use a treat once in a while. I wouldn't try petting just let them come to you. It could take a while.
 
Might be angel wing , heres a link and pics. as far as getting them to trust you, just as crj said spend time with them outside, just sitting with them, talking to them quitely. just your calm presence will probably win them over. I'm sure they have been stressed alot being at an animal shelter.
